The warm season not only attracts people outside, but also some types of wasps who are interested in our dishes and drinks. There are numerous types of wasps in Germany, of which only two types, the common wasp and the German wasp, want to afford us at the coffee table. But no reason to worry, because garden expert Corinna Hölzel from the Bund for the Environment and Nature Conservation Germany (BUND) soothes how to deal with wasps at the table and a wasp nest in the garden.

To keep annoying wasps away, you can lure them away from the table with an overripe piece of fruit. It is important to keep calm and avoid violent movements because they can irritate the animals. The blowing away or applying perfume should also be avoided, as this can make the wasps aggressive. Food and sweet drinks should be covered and cleared after eating. Special caution is advised when small children sit at the table, as these wasps often perceive as a kind of threat. If there is still a wasp sting, it is advisable to keep an onion or use a battery -operated stitch healer. With a spray bottle you can drive out individual animals.

However, there are also a variety of wasp species that are not interested in our food and therefore leave us alone. These species only become aggressive when they see their nest threatened. Some examples of this are the field wasp, the middle wasp and the Saxon wasp.

The harmless wasp types build their nests in different ways. The nests of most of the types of wasp are gray and hang free, but can reach the size of a football. The nests of the common and the German wasp, on the other hand, are usually underground in the ground and can only be recognized by the entry hole. For security reasons, these nests should not be entered or disturbed by people.

wasps are an important part of our ecosystems, since they contribute to the pollination of our plants and eliminate AAS. For this reason, wasps are protected in accordance with the Federal Nature Conservation Act. The removal of wasp nests should therefore only be carried out in exceptional cases and by experts. In such cases, the animals can be sucked into a special fishing box, cut off the nest and both are reunited in another place so that the wasps can develop undisturbed there.

However, there are also simple solutions to facilitate living together with wasps. If a wasp nest was built in the immediate vicinity of your own living area, a panel can be attached as a privacy screen. This should be attached about ten centimeters below the nest, so that the wasps do not perceive human movements. As a result, they do not feel threatened and stay calm. For example, an old bed sheet or a tablecloth that is fixed with adhesive tape can serve as a privacy screen. However, it must be ensured that the wasp trajectory is not cut off.

By the way, wasps do not colonize abandoned nests again and do not build new nests in the immediate vicinity of the old. Therefore, it makes sense to let the abandoned wasp nests hang in order to prevent another settlement in the same place.
